2000 Sparkassen Cup (tennis)

The 2000 Sparkassen Cup was a tennis tournament played on indoor hard courts in Leipzig, Germany. It was part of the Tier II category of the 2000 WTA Tour. It was the 11th edition of the tournament and was held from 30 October through 5 November 2000. Unseeded Kim Clijsters won the singles title and earned $87,000 first-prize money.

Finals
SinglesKim Clijsters defeated Elena Likhovtseva, 7–6(8–6), 4–6, 6–4. It was the 2nd title of the season for Clijsters and the 3rd title of her singles career. DoublesArantxa Sánchez Vicario / Anne-Gaëlle Sidot defeated Kim Clijsters / Laurence Courtois, 6–7(8–6), 7–5, 6–3.
